Penelope Cruz Opens Up About Relationship With Javier Bardem and Coping with Challenging Roles

In a rare interview for the new issue of ELLE, actress Penelope Cruz has given a glimpse into her relationship with husband Javier Bardem. The couple, known for their privacy, revealed a fun side of their family life, with Cruz sharing how Bardem keeps them entertained with his funny impressions.
Cruz described Bardem as not only a great singer and dancer but also an amazing impersonator. He can imitate iconic figures like Mick Jagger, Al Pacino, and Robert De Niro, creating a lively and entertaining atmosphere for their family.
However, alongside her personal revelations, Cruz delved into the professional challenges she faces in her acting career. She opened up about how she copes with the "uncomfortable and painful" roles she takes on. The actress admitted that she relies on therapy to regulate the empathy she feels for her characters. Cruz emphasized the importance of finding a balance so she can still experience the emotions without internalizing them as her own.
Cruz explained that she experiences a heightened sensitivity in various aspects of her life as a result of her profession. This hypersensitivity, she believes, allows her to connect deeply with others and cultivate compassion. While the process of letting go of her roles can be difficult, she noted that each experience leaves her feeling more compassionate than before.
The interview also touched upon Cruz's dedication to protecting the privacy of her two young children. The actress expressed her commitment to shield them from the public eye, allowing them to grow up with a sense of normalcy.
Additionally, Cruz discussed her recent portrayal of Laura Ferrari in Michael Mann's biopic Ferrari. She revealed that she felt a responsibility to give the character a voice, as Ferrari, the wife of Enzo Ferrari played by Adam Driver, had been misunderstood and misrepresented. Cruz was inspired by real love letters between the couple, which showcased their strong love and respect, even amidst turmoil and betrayal.
In preparing for the role, Cruz visited the Ferrari factory in Modena and met people who knew Laura. She discovered a hidden power and strength in the character that others seemed reluctant to acknowledge. Despite being labeled "difficult" or "crazy," Laura's actions demonstrated her commitment and determination, such as sleeping with the tires to prevent sabotage before races. Cruz highlighted the importance of challenging societal norms and stereotypes that have unjustly suppressed women throughout history.
